About the Program
The Internationally Educated Healthcare Professionals (IEHP) Support Program helps internationally trained healthcare professionals understand and navigate the licensure and employment pathways in Nova Scotia.
Whether you are a medical laboratory technologist, physiotherapist or another healthcare professional, the program offers individualized support, up-to-date information on regulatory requirements and referrals to bridging, training or assessment programs.
The program is designed to help participants create a personalized plan for professional success, whether returning to a regulated healthcare profession, exploring alternative career options or both.
